18 Year Old Trying to become NYC youngest Council member


Abraham Tischler from Brooklyn, is trying to become the youngest person to be elected to New York City council. He is trying to get the Borough Park Council seat that was once held by Simcha Felder, who recently accepted a job with the Controller John Liu. The Touro College sophomore said his inexperience would help him in the long run, since he doesn't owe any favors. One of Tischler main goals once he becomes councilmen is to save student Metrocards, which is on chopping block for the Metropolitan Transportation Agency as it looks to close a multi-million dollar budget gap.  One of Tischler opponents, 31 year old David Greenfield has launched a lawsuit against Tischler, claiming his petitions have forged and duplicated signatures. In all Tishler has gathered 1,415 signatures and adamantly denies any of them are lacking validity.Greenfield formally chief of staff for Assemblyman Dov Hikind, seems to be Mayor Bloomberg's pick for the seat and is considered one of the front runners. So far he has raised $131,000 for the race. Tischler's father, who has capped spending for his son's campaign at $1,000,is callingthe lawsuit ridiculous. He claims Greenfield is simply trying to knock his son off the ballot because he's scared.
